Some funny names I've heard of.



In gujjuland, I had a classmate whose brother's name was spelt H E A T. And was pronounced as Haith (as in faith), which in gujju means love.



Another guy I knew was named Ripple. Still trying to figure out how his dad managed that. :twisted:



And one of my uncles who works in Nagaland told me about the funny names tribals have there. Imagine him having to interact with people called Rolling Stone Sangma, Spark Plug & Steppney (the son and daughter of the local motor mechanic) and Toshiba.
